Why you'll love this job
This job is within the American Airlines Credit Union. The role is responsible for supporting the strategic growth, performance, and ongoing optimization of the Credit Union’s checking account and credit card products. This Analyst functions as a product-focused team member, leveraging data analysis, market insights, and cross-functional collaboration to help ensure transactional and deposit-related offerings remain competitive, aligned with member needs, and supportive of organizational growth objectives. This role partners closely with internal stakeholders and external vendors to support product enhancements, execute growth initiatives, and drive product adoption, engagement, financial performance, and strong member experiences across checking accounts, credit cards, and related payment services.
What you'll do
- Lead efforts to execute a comprehensive roadmap for cards and payments products, including enhancements to existing programs and features that support adoption, engagement, and growth initiatives
- Develop data-driven insights and recommendations to support product growth, improve member experience, and increase overall product performance
- Identify and evaluate opportunities to enhance product features, ancillary services (e.g., overdraft protection, rewards programs, fees), and digital payment capabilities
- Monitor and analyze performance metrics for checking account and credit card products, including member engagement, adoption, transaction activity, and revenue performance
- Support execution of product initiatives and enhancements in partnership with digital, operations, risk, compliance, and other cross-functional teams
- Collaborate with Marketing to plan and execute campaigns that increase checking account and credit card usage, deepen member engagement, and drive interchange growth
- Assist in the development and maintenance of dashboards, scorecards, and reporting tools to track product performance and measure initiative impact
- Conduct analysis of member behavior, transaction trends, and product usage patterns to inform strategy and prioritization
- Support vendor relationship management by tracking performance, coordinating deliverables, and assisting with evaluation of third-party solutions supporting checking account features and payment services
- Conduct market research and competitive analysis to identify emerging trends, opportunities, and risks within the payments and financial services landscape
- Prepare reports, presentations, and performance updates for leadership and cross-functional stakeholders
- The selected candidate will be responsible for ensuring the security and confidentiality of all account and related information which is part of their work and for ensuring that his/her work is in compliance with all applicable laws and regulations including, but not limited to, the Bank Secrecy Act.
